How to Create and Verify Your Kraken Account for Meme Coin Purchases

Before accessing low-cap meme tokens on Kraken, you need to register a personal account through their secure onboarding process. This step is mandatory for all users and ensures full access to spot trading and crypto funding features.

Verification levels determine your ability to deposit fiat, enable margin, or unlock additional trading pairs. Meme coin transactions typically require the "Intermediate" level, which involves identity checks and residency confirmation.

Step-by-Step Account Setup and Verification

  1. Visit Kraken's official website and click on "Create Account".
  2. Enter your email address, choose a strong password, and confirm your country of residence.
  3. Open your email and click the activation link to proceed.
  4. Log in and navigate to the verification section of your profile dashboard.
  • Starter level: Allows crypto deposits and withdrawals but limited trading options.
  • Intermediate level: Required for meme coin purchases; includes ID and proof of address submission.
  • Pro level: Higher limits and OTC access, not necessary for most meme assets.

Note: Ensure your name matches exactly across all submitted documents to avoid delays in approval.

Verification Tier Requirements Access Granted
Starter Email, full name, date of birth, phone number Basic crypto deposits and trades
Intermediate Valid ID, proof of residence, face photo Fiat funding, meme coin trading, futures
Pro Enhanced due diligence Higher limits, advanced tools

How to Deposit Funds Into Your Kraken Account to Buy Meme Coins

Before exploring trending tokens, you’ll need to top up your Kraken balance using one of the accepted payment methods. Kraken supports bank transfers, crypto deposits, and some region-specific options, each with different processing times and fees.

Accurate funding is critical–errors like sending funds to the wrong wallet address or skipping reference codes may result in delays or loss of funds. Always double-check the deposit instructions provided by Kraken before proceeding.

Steps to Add Money to Your Kraken Wallet

  1. Log in to your Kraken account and navigate to the "Funding" section.
  2. Choose your preferred currency (e.g., USD, EUR, BTC).
  3. Click on the "Deposit" button next to the selected currency.
  4. Follow the instructions specific to your payment method (e.g., SEPA, FedWire, crypto wallet).
  5. Copy and use the provided reference or memo code exactly as shown.

Note: Crypto deposits require blockchain confirmations before appearing in your account. Fiat transfers may take up to 5 business days depending on the bank.

  • SEPA transfers: Best for users in the EU. Typically processed within 1–2 business days.
  • SWIFT or FedWire: Suitable for international users. May incur additional fees.
  • Crypto deposits: Fast and usually fee-free, depending on network congestion.
Method Processing Time Fees
Bank Transfer (SEPA) 1–2 Business Days Usually Free
FedWire (USD) 2–5 Business Days $5–$35
Cryptocurrency 10–60 Minutes Varies by Network

What Order Types to Use When Buying Meme Coins on Kraken

When purchasing high-volatility digital assets on Kraken, such as meme-based tokens, selecting the correct order type is essential. These cryptocurrencies often experience sudden price fluctuations, making precise entry points critical for minimizing risk and optimizing returns.

Kraken offers multiple order options tailored for different market scenarios. Whether you're aiming to secure a coin during a dip or avoid slippage in a fast-moving market, the right strategy starts with choosing the right order type.

Available Order Types and When to Use Them

  • Market Order: Executes immediately at the best available price. Ideal for fast execution but may suffer from price slippage during volatile trading.
  • Limit Order: Allows you to specify the exact price at which you're willing to buy. Best for controlling entry points in unpredictable markets.
  • Stop-Loss Order: Triggers a market order when a specific price is hit. Useful for protecting against sudden downturns in meme coin value.

Tip: For highly volatile meme tokens, avoid using market orders during sudden price spikes. They can fill at significantly higher prices than expected.

Order Type Best Use Case Risk Level
Market Immediate purchase during high volume High
Limit Entry at a specific target price Moderate
Stop-Loss Protecting gains or limiting losses Low (for risk control)
  1. Determine your acceptable entry price and risk tolerance.
  2. Choose a limit order for precise execution or a market order for immediacy.
  3. Set stop-loss thresholds to prevent major losses in case of unexpected drops.

How to Check Fees and Minimize Costs When Trading Meme Coins

Before jumping into meme coin trading on Kraken, it's essential to understand the platform’s fee structure. Each trade incurs costs that can eat into profits if not managed carefully. Trading fees vary based on your 30-day volume and whether you're placing maker or taker orders.

To avoid surprises, always verify current fees on Kraken’s official fee schedule. Additionally, consider the costs associated with deposits, withdrawals, and spreads, especially with volatile meme assets where price slippage is common.

Steps to Review and Reduce Your Expenses

  • Review Tiered Fee Schedule: Go to Kraken’s “Trading Fees” page to find your applicable rates based on your trading volume.
  • Use Maker Orders: Limit orders that add liquidity often have lower fees compared to taker (market) orders.
  • Avoid High-Fee Tokens: Some meme coins carry higher withdrawal costs–check this before moving funds.
  • Consolidate Trades: Instead of multiple small trades, execute fewer large orders to reduce cumulative fees.

Always double-check fees under the “Funding” and “Trading” sections in Kraken’s account dashboard. This ensures you’re accounting for all potential costs, not just trading fees.

Fee Type Description How to Minimize
Maker Fee Applies when adding liquidity Use limit orders
Taker Fee Applies when removing liquidity Trade during low volatility hours
Withdrawal Fee Flat fee per crypto asset Select assets with low network costs
  1. Login to your Kraken account
  2. Navigate to “Fees” section
  3. Check trading and withdrawal rates for each asset
  4. Plan trades to maximize maker activity

How to Safely Store Meme Coins After Purchasing on Kraken

Once you’ve purchased meme coins on Kraken, it’s crucial to understand how to store them securely. While Kraken provides a wallet service for users, many prefer to move their assets to external wallets for better control and enhanced security. Depending on your goals–whether you plan to hold your coins for a long time or make frequent trades–there are different storage options available to you.

After buying meme coins, consider these storage methods to ensure the safety and accessibility of your assets. The type of wallet you choose should align with your needs for security and ease of access.

Secure Storage Options for Meme Coins

  • Kraken Wallet: Kraken allows you to store your meme coins directly in your exchange account. This option is convenient for those who trade often but may not provide the highest level of security.
  • Hot Wallets: Hot wallets are online wallets that can be accessed via your phone or computer. They are easy to use, but they come with higher risks due to their connection to the internet.
  • Cold Wallets: Cold wallets, such as hardware wallets, store your meme coins offline. This is considered one of the safest options, as they are not vulnerable to online hacks.

Steps to Transfer Meme Coins from Kraken to an External Wallet

  1. Set Up Your External Wallet: Choose a wallet that supports the meme coins you've purchased. Options include hardware wallets like Ledger and Trezor, or software wallets like MetaMask.
  2. Obtain Your Wallet Address: After setting up your wallet, copy the wallet address. This is where you’ll send your meme coins.
  3. Withdraw from Kraken: Log into Kraken, go to your asset page, and select the withdrawal option. Paste your wallet address and the amount of meme coins you wish to transfer.
  4. Confirm the Transfer: Double-check the details before confirming. Once processed, the meme coins will be sent to your external wallet for safe storage.

Important Note: Always ensure that the address you enter is correct. Cryptocurrency transactions are irreversible, and any mistakes could result in a permanent loss of your assets.

Comparing Storage Options

Storage Option Security Level Ease of Use Best For
Kraken Wallet Medium High Frequent traders
Hot Wallet Medium High Active users
Cold Wallet High Low Long-term holders

Risks to Consider When Purchasing Meme Coins on Kraken

Meme coins have become increasingly popular due to their viral nature and potential for high returns. However, purchasing these coins on platforms like Kraken comes with several risks that every investor should consider before diving into this market. Meme coins are inherently volatile and often lack fundamental value, making them a risky investment option. Here are some key risks to be aware of when trading meme coins on Kraken.

One of the biggest challenges is the high volatility in the prices of meme coins. These cryptocurrencies can experience rapid price swings, often driven by social media trends, celebrity endorsements, or sudden community interest. As a result, investors can either see significant gains or suffer substantial losses in a short period. Understanding these risks is crucial for making informed investment decisions.

Key Risks to Watch

  • Price Fluctuations: Meme coins are known for their extreme price volatility, which can lead to unpredictable market conditions.
  • Market Manipulation: These assets can be subject to pump-and-dump schemes, where groups manipulate the price for quick gains at the expense of others.
  • Lack of Regulation: Many meme coins are not backed by substantial projects or regulatory frameworks, increasing the risk of fraud or mismanagement.

Things to Watch Out For

  1. Shifting Trends: Trends on social media can rapidly change, causing the value of meme coins to drop just as quickly as they rise.
  2. Limited Liquidity: Some meme coins may have low trading volumes, making it difficult to buy or sell without affecting the price.
  3. Security Risks: Always ensure that your Kraken account is secured and use two-factor authentication to protect your assets.

Always invest only what you can afford to lose. The nature of meme coins makes them highly speculative and should be approached with caution.

Additional Considerations

Risk Factor Impact
Price Volatility Can result in significant financial loss or gain within a short period.
Lack of Regulation Increases the likelihood of scams or fraudulent projects.
Market Sentiment Price changes driven by social media trends, making the market highly unpredictable.
